Potassium Tellurite Hydrate is noted for its consistent composition and reliable behavior. Its molecular formula, K2O3Te, consists of potassium, oxygen, tellurium, and water molecules. With a molecular weight of 253.8 g/mol, this compound belongs to the family of inorganic salts. It exhibits unique properties due to its complex structure, which includes the presence of tellurium, a chalcogen. This compound carries the hazard signal word "Danger," indicating potential toxicity if ingested. Additionally, it is classified as acutely toxic via the oral route
